HANDOVER NOTE — Safe Lock Replacement, Bay 4

Tomas, picking up from my shift: the old dial lock on the Bay 4 safe failed inspection, so Ironquill Locksmiths machined a replacement unit. It's boxed, sealed with two tamper strips, and stored in the secure cage under my sign-off. Do not open the box; the fitter from Ironquill will verify the seals on arrival Friday. A courier from Saddleback Express collects it at 09:00. Hand the package over only after giving the courier this instruction:

dispatch memo: the quenax olidor courier leaves the lamvan aldath keliel ledger at gate 2085 under passcode 005795

Welcome to on-call for the Glimmerpane design system! Our snapshot tests live in the `snapcheck` suite and run on every merge to main. If a UI component changes visually, the diff bot flags it — usually it's an intentional tweak, so just approve the new baseline. If it's 2am and snapshots are failing across the board, it's almost always a font-loading race, not your problem. To unlock the baseline store and re-approve snapshots in bulk, use the recovery passphrase below.

recovery phrase for tahag-taguf: wenix-caswyn

Internal Memo — Inventory Write-Down, Kestrel Line

To: Sales Leads

Following the annual stock review at the Dunholt warehouse, we are recording a write-down on aging Kestrel-series units. The figure is larger than last year's adjustment, driven mainly by the mid-cycle model refresh. Please redirect customer interest toward the newer Kestrel Pro range and avoid discounting legacy stock without approval. Context from the executive committee follows:

management briefing: Only 5 of the 80 pilot accounts renewed Zorix, so a churn review is set for October 1.